This pull request removes regression tests related to the C semantics from our repository.


Review checklist

The author performs the actions on the checklist. The reviewer evaluates the work and checks the boxes as they are completed.

  • Summary. Write a summary of the changes. Explain what you did to fix the issue, and why you did it. Present the changes in a logical order. Instead of writing a summary in the pull request, you may push a clean Git history.
  • Documentation. Write documentation for new functions. Update documentation for functions that changed, or complete documentation where it is missing.
  • Tests. Write unit tests for every change. Write the unit tests that were missing before the changes. Include any examples from the reported issue as integration tests.
  • Clean up. The changes are already clean. Clean up anything near the changes that you noticed while working. This does not mean only spatially near the changes, but logically near: any code that interacts with the changes!
